DETECTIVES in Bournemouth are hunting a man who exposed himself to a teenage girl.
During the incident, which took place between noon and 12.18pm last Saturday, August 23, the 15-year-old was flashed as she walked through recreation land between Harewood Avenue and Chaseside.
The offender is described as white, aged between 20 and 30 years old, five feet nine inches tall with short cropped curly brown hair. He was clean shaven, wearing thin framed, black rectangular glasses and a navy blue jumper with a white shirt collar exposed.
PC Ali Cox, of Bournemouth police, said: “I am keen to speak with anyone who may have information that can help to identify the offender.
“Witnesses to the incident and anyone who saw a man of that description acting suspiciously in the area at the time are asked to contact police. “ Witnesses and anyone with information should call Dorset Police in confidence on 101 quoting incident number 23:226.
